Bujumbura City Market, affectionately known as Siyoni Market, is the beating heart of Bujumbura, where the essence of Burundian culture thrives amidst a cacophony of sights, sounds, and scents. This vibrant market is a must-visit for anyone traveling to the capital, offering an authentic glimpse into the daily lives of locals. As you wander through the labyrinth of stalls, you'll be greeted by the colorful displays of fresh produce, aromatic spices, and handcrafted goods that showcase the rich craftsmanship of Burundian artisans. The market is not only a shopping destination but also a social hub, where locals gather to catch up, barter, and share stories. The unique atmosphere is enhanced by the tantalizing aroma of street food wafting through the air. Vendors proudly serve traditional dishes that reflect the diverse culinary heritage of the region. Sampling local delights such as brochettes, fried plantains, and fresh fruit juices is an experience you won't want to miss. Don’t forget to engage with the friendly vendors, many of whom are eager to share insights about their products and the culture of Burundi. Visiting Siyoni Market is more than just a shopping experience; it’s an opportunity to connect with the local community and immerse yourself in the vibrant daily life of Bujumbura. Whether you’re looking for unique souvenirs, fresh ingredients, or simply a taste of local culture, this market promises an unforgettable experience that captures the spirit of Burundi.
Local tips
- Visit early in the morning to experience the market at its liveliest and to find the freshest produce.
- Don't hesitate to bargain with vendors; it's part of the local shopping culture.
- Try the local street food, but make sure to choose vendors with a busy clientele for the best flavors.
- Keep your belongings secure, as the market can get crowded, especially during peak hours.
- Bring cash, as many vendors may not accept credit cards.

Getting There
-
Car
If you are driving from any location in Buyenzi, head towards Avenue de l'OUA. Depending on your starting point, you may need to navigate through local streets to reach this main avenue. Once on Avenue de l'OUA, continue driving straight until you reach the coordinates J9P5+5MP. The market will be on your left, and you can find parking nearby. Be aware that parking may incur a small fee.
-
Public Transportation (Minibus)
To reach Bujumbura City Market using public transportation, locate a minibus (known as 'taxi-brousse') heading towards Avenue de l'OUA. You can catch these minibuses at various points around Buyenzi. The fare is typically around 500 Burundian Francs. Inform the driver of your destination, and they will drop you off close to the market. After disembarking, walk a short distance towards the coordinates J9P5+5MP, where the market is located.
-
Walking
If you are within walking distance in Buyenzi, head towards Avenue de l'OUA. Use landmarks such as local shops or parks to guide you. Once you are on Avenue de l'OUA, walk south until you reach the market at J9P5+5MP. This is approximately a 15-20 minute walk from central Buyenzi. Be sure to stay aware of your surroundings and cross streets carefully, as traffic can be busy.
